Thermoplastic Immobilization Mask FamilyS-Frame H&N · Full-Face Cranial + SRS · Full-Body Shell
Three-SKU thermoplastic mask family covering the whole external-beam radiotherapy anatomy — S-Frame head-and-neck (RT-001), full-face cranial + intracranial SRS (RT-002), full-body thoracic shell (RT-003). Low-temperature 65 °C activation bath softens the perforated polymer sheet at simulation; the sheet moulds to the patient, hardens as it cools, and locks the patient shape into the same shell every fraction. Indexed to standard couch-bar-pitch baseplates; MR-compatible fastener set available for MR-linac + MR-sim workflows. Peer-reviewed setup accuracy across every workflow the family covers — sub-2 mm 6D translational error under daily MVCT (You 2024), sub-millimetre systematic error on MR-Linac (Cuccia 2021), and quantified SRS intrafractional drift plateau at ~ 10 min under mask fixation (Mangesius 2019).

Applications
Six worked treatment workflows the mask family covers
Routine head-and-neck IMRT / VMAT
RT-001 S-Frame mask on a standard H&N baseplate + shoulder-retraction strap. Daily MVCT / CBCT verification confirms sub-2 mm mean 6D translational setup error (You 2024 · 30 patients / 920 images). The workhorse configuration for the majority of the departmental H&N caseload.
Intracranial SRS / SRT
RT-002 full-face SRS mask + O-frame + SRS bite-block. Intrafractional 3D drift 0.21 mm (0-2 min) → 0.53 mm plateau at 10 min under mask fixation (Mangesius 2019 · 96 fractions). Sets the SRS beam-on ceiling per fraction under AAPM TG-42 < 2 mm targeting.
MR-Linac + MR-guided radiotherapy
RT-001 or RT-002 + non-ferromagnetic fastener set + MR-compatible baseplate. Multi-centre European review confirms < 1 mm systematic translational error with the MR-compatible thermoplastic mask + coil-compatible workflow (Cuccia 2021).
Paediatric brain-tumour SRT
RT-002 paediatric-size full-face mask + O-frame + paediatric bite-block. Same physics as the adult SRS configuration but sized for paediatric anatomy; the low-temperature activation avoids the moulding-time burn risk that would otherwise limit paediatric use.
Trunk / thorax IGRT + IMRT
RT-003 body shell + indexed thorax baseplate + arm supports. The body-shell restrains trunk motion across the fraction series; pairs with the thermoplastic head mask (RT-001 or RT-002) for the H&N-and-nodal treatment plans that need dual immobilisation.
Customised 3-point re-irradiation immobilisation
RT-001 or RT-002 + custom cushion + SRS bite-block. MD Anderson published a 21-patient / 105-session H&N SRT re-irradiation cohort where this configuration corrected initial 2.7 ± 1.4 mm 3D setup vectors to 0.0 ± 0.3 mm per-axis residuals — 2.0 mm PTV margin achievable (Wang 2016 · JACMP).
Why Thermoplastic Immobilization Mask Family?
The perforated polymer softens in a 65 °C water bath — well below the patient burn threshold. The RTT moulds the softened sheet directly to the patient at simulation; the sheet cools and hardens into a patient-specific shell within minutes. No pre-scanning, no third-party cast fabrication, no simulator turn-around delay.
A 30-patient / 40-mask / 920-image daily-MVCT H&N cohort showed mean 6D translational setup errors of 0.32 mm (X), −1.09 mm (Y) and 2.24 mm (Z) — well inside the CTV-to-PTV 3-5 mm margin used in standard H&N IMRT. Rotational errors below 0.4° on every axis. That's what a modern thermoplastic-mask workflow delivers on the daily image-guided cadence.
A multi-centre European review anchors the MR-compatible thermoplastic mask + non-ferromagnetic fastener + coil-compatible-baseplate workflow at < 1 mm systematic translational setup error on MR-Linac + MR-sim. The same shell transfers from CT-sim to MR-sim to MR-Linac without per-room recalibration.

Accessories Matrix
| Mask-water bath (65 °C thermostat) | Low-temperature activation bath softens the thermoplastic sheet for moulding to the patient at simulation; thermostat holds the working range without operator supervision |
| Mould-room work surface + tools | Scissors, thermal gloves + reshaping tool for the moulding step; the mould-room fit is done at simulation and the mask ships to the treatment room with the patient plan |
| Shoulder-retraction strap | H&N-specific accessory paired with RT-001 — reproduces the shoulder-down position across fractions; reduces the neck-flexion setup uncertainty that would otherwise absorb margin |
| SRS bite-block (H&N + cranial) | Additional intra-oral fixation for stereotactic use (RT-002); the customised 3-point cushion + mask + bite-block combination has been shown to bring 3D residual setup errors to ~ 0.0 ± 0.3 mm per axis (Wang 2016 · MD Anderson) |
| MRI-compatible fastener set | Non-ferromagnetic hook / lock hardware for MR-linac + MR-sim workflows; the mask itself is polymer and MR-safe by default |
| Patient-comfort cushion | Between the mask and the skin — reduces pressure points across a 20-30 fraction series; does not compromise the shell fit or the setup reproducibility |
| Storage rack (per-patient labelled) | Between-fraction storage in the treatment-room ante-space; each patient's mask is labelled with treatment-plan ID + fraction schedule |
| Per-batch material + moulding certificate | ISO 13485-aligned material record — passive-accessory dossier that ships alongside the medical-device import paperwork under CDSCO Medical Devices Rules 2017 |

AAPM TG-176 — Dosimetric effects of couch tops + immobilisation devices
AAPM Task Group 176 open-access report — the framework for attenuation, skin-dose build-up loss and shifted-dose-distribution effects of immobilisation devices in the treatment-planning system.
AAPM TG-42 — Stereotactic radiosurgery
AAPM Task Group 42 report — sets the < 2 mm overall targeting-error target for intracranial SRS that the RT-002 full-face + SRS-frame configuration is engineered against.
ICRU Report 91 — Prescribing, recording, and reporting stereotactic treatments with small photon beams
ICRU framework governing SRS / SRT stereotactic delivery — small-field dosimetry, GTV / CTV / PTV concepts and geometric-accuracy requirements the mask family plugs into.
CDSCO Medical Devices Rules 2017 (India)
Central Drugs Standard Control Organisation regulatory framework for medical-device import + registration in India. The route Class A passive-accessory immobilisation devices (masks, cushions, baseplates) go through — AERB does not licence non-radioactive positioning accessories.
